Insurance claims for vehicles, be it a car or two-wheeler, are entertained only if the damage is accidental, due to natural disasters, theft or accidental fire. Here are some reasons your claim could be rejected or not fully paid by your vehicle insurer.
Take the vehicle to the garage for repairs as soon as the accident happens. All bills issued by the garage need to be submitted to the insurance company. Once a claim is made, no-claim bonus applicable on the policy will not be available for the next renewal.
